Why Attic Ventilation Matters in Clifton
Prevents Moisture and Mold
Clifton's humid summers create ideal conditions for moisture accumulation in poorly ventilated attics. This leads to mold growth, wood rot, and compromised insulation. Proper ventilation expels humid air while drawing in dry outdoor air, keeping your attic dry and reducing health risks.
Extends Your Roof's Lifespan
Excessive heat damages shingles in summer, while ice dams cause destruction in winter. Maintaining balanced attic temperatures prevents premature aging and helps your roof reach its full lifespan.
Lowers Energy Bills
Well-ventilated attics reduce HVAC strain year-round. In summer, hot air escapes naturally, decreasing cooling costs. In winter, proper airflow prevents moisture buildup and ice dams while minimizing heat loss through the roof deck.
Stops Ice Dams
Ice dams form when warm attic air melts roof snow, which then refreezes at the eaves and backs up under shingles, causing water damage. Proper ventilation keeps your roof deck cold and uniform in temperature—critical during Clifton's snowy winters.
Types of Attic Vents
Ridge Vents
Ridge vents run along the roof peak and exhaust hot, humid air through natural convection. They're nearly invisible from the ground, provide continuous airflow along the entire ridge, and have no moving parts to break or require maintenance.
Soffit Vents
Installed under the eaves, soffit vents draw fresh, cool air into the attic. Effective ventilation requires balanced intake and exhaust—typically a 1:1 ratio of soffit to ridge vent area.
Ridge + Soffit: The Best System
Ridge and soffit vents create the most efficient ventilation system for Clifton homes. Soffit vents pull cool air in at the bottom while ridge vents exhaust hot air at the top, establishing continuous airflow that maintains balanced temperature and moisture levels. This combination is both effective and discreet.
Other Options: Gable, Turbine, and Box Vents
Gable vents mount on attic ends, turbine vents use wind power to exhaust air, and box vents provide static roof exhaust. While functional, these options don't provide the balanced, continuous airflow of ridge-soffit systems. Your choice depends on roof design and specific structural requirements.

Calculate What You Need
The standard rule requires 1 square foot of ventilation per 300 square feet of attic floor space, split evenly between intake (50%) and exhaust (50%). Clifton's climate and local building codes may require adjustments, so measure your attic carefully and verify requirements before proceeding.
Install Soffit Vents Correctly
First, ensure insulation doesn't block airflow by installing vent baffles along the entire soffit. Cut openings for continuous vents, then secure them with proper tools and sealant to prevent leaks and maintain unobstructed airflow.
Install Ridge Vents Properly
Cut a slot along the ridge (typically 1-1.5 inches wide), then position the ridge vent over the opening. Fasten securely using manufacturer-recommended underlayment and roof nails. Proper sealing prevents leaks—common mistakes include undersizing the slot and inadequate weatherproofing.
Balance Intake and Exhaust
Verify that intake and exhaust vent areas are equal using airflow calculators if needed. For Clifton homes, the ridge-soffit combination provides optimal balance. Avoid mixing incompatible vent types that disrupt airflow patterns.
Warning Signs of Poor Ventilation
What to Look For
Watch for these indicators: ice dams on the roof in winter, unexpectedly high heating or cooling bills, moisture or mold in the attic, rusted nails or fasteners, curled or damaged shingles, and rooms that are uncomfortably hot or cold. Any of these symptoms warrant immediate inspection.
How to Inspect Your Attic
Check for blocked vents (from debris, insulation, or nests), damaged or missing vents, insufficient vent area, moisture stains, mold growth, and frost on roof sheathing. Use a flashlight and thermometer to assess airflow and temperature distribution.
DIY vs Professional Repair
Simple fixes like clearing debris from vents or adding vent baffles are manageable DIY tasks. However, installing new vents, repairing structural damage, or addressing extensive mold requires professional expertise. Always prioritize safety when accessing your attic or roof.
When to Call a Contractor
Contact a Clifton roofing contractor if you observe persistent moisture, extensive mold growth, or chronically high energy bills. A professional performs thorough inspections and recommends appropriate repairs or system upgrades.
Professional Attic Ventilation Repair
What a Professional Inspection Includes
A contractor examines your attic, vents, and roof structure, measures airflow, checks for blockages, assesses insulation condition, identifies moisture damage, and provides a detailed report with repair recommendations.
Common Repairs
Typical work includes removing debris or insulation from vents, replacing cracked or missing soffit vents, repairing damaged ridge vents, fixing sealant issues, and adding vents or baffles when airflow is insufficient.
Repair Costs in Clifton
Minor vent unblocking typically costs $100-$300, while replacing multiple vents or installing new systems ranges from $500-$2,000 depending on scope. Obtain multiple quotes from local contractors to compare pricing and services.
